Thanks. -smage -----Original Message----- From: owner-freebsd-questions@freebsd.org [mailto:owner-freebsd-questions@freebsd.org]On Behalf Of $mage Sent: Monday, April 14, 2003 2:50 PM To: freebsd-questions@freebsd.org Subject: burncd data (error) Hi, Im trying to burn a an iso image to a cdr. I used mkisofs with boot.flp to create my 4.8-boot.iso image. I am doing this cuz my floppy drive died. When I do: burncd -f /dev/acd0c -s max data 4.8-boot.iso fixate I get the following: next writeable LBA 557 writing from file 4.8-boot.iso size 2976 KB acd0: WRITE_BIG - ILLEGAL REQUEST asc=0x64 ascq=0x00 error=0x04 only wrote -1 of 32768 bytes err=5 fixating CD, please wait.. acd0: CLOSE_TRACKING/SESSION - ILLEGAL REQUEST asc=0x72 ascq=0x04 error=0x04 burncd: icotl(CDRIOCFIXATE): Input/output error Any insight on this issue?
